#!/usr/bin/env nextflow
nextflow.enable.dsl=2
/**
===============================
Exome Pipeline
===============================
This Pipeline performs variant calling
using Google DeepVariant
### Homepage / git
git@github.com:ikmb/exome-seq.git
### Implementation
Re-Implemented in Q1 2023
Author: Marc P. Hoeppner, m.hoeppner@ikmb.uni-kiel.de
**/
def summary = [:]
WorkflowMain.initialise(workflow, params, log)
WorkflowExomes.initialise( params, log)
//
// Summary of all options
//
summary['runName'] = params.run_name
summary['Samples'] = params.samples
summary['Current home'] = "$HOME"
summary['Current user'] = "$USER"
summary['Current path'] = "$PWD"
summary['Assembly'] = params.fasta
summary['JointCalling'] = params.joint_calling
summary['CommandLine'] = workflow.commandLine
if (workflow.containerEngine) {
summary['Container'] = "$workflow.containerEngine - $workflow.container"
}
summary['IntervallPadding'] = params.interval_padding
summary['SessionID'] = workflow.sessionId
if (params.amplicon_bed) {
summary['AmpliconBedFile'] = params.amplicon_bed
}
def multiqc_report = Channel.from([])
include { BUILD_REFERENCES } from "./workflows/build_references"
if (!params.build_references) {
include { EXOME_SEQ } from "./workflows/exome-seq.nf"
}
workflow {
if (params.build_references) {
BUILD_REFERENCES()
} else {
EXOME_SEQ()
multiqc_report = multiqc_report.mix(EXOME_SEQ.out.qc).toList()
}
}
workflow.onComplete {
log.info "========================================="
log.info "Duration: $workflow.duration"
log.info "========================================="
def email_fields = [:]
email_fields['version'] = workflow.manifest.version
email_fields['session'] = workflow.sessionId
email_fields['runName'] = run_name
email_fields['Samples'] = params.samples
email_fields['success'] = workflow.success
email_fields['dateStarted'] = workflow.start
email_fields['dateComplete'] = workflow.complete
email_fields['duration'] = workflow.duration
email_fields['exitStatus'] = workflow.exitStatus
email_fields['errorMessage'] = (workflow.errorMessage ?: 'None')
email_fields['errorReport'] = (workflow.errorReport ?: 'None')
email_fields['commandLine'] = workflow.commandLine
email_fields['projectDir'] = workflow.projectDir
email_fields['script_file'] = workflow.scriptFile
email_fields['launchDir'] = workflow.launchDir
email_fields['user'] = workflow.userName
email_fields['Pipeline script hash ID'] = workflow.scriptId
email_fields['kit'] = TARGETS
email_fields['assembly'] = FASTA
email_fields['manifest'] = workflow.manifest
email_fields['summary'] = summary
email_info = ""
for (s in email_fields) {
email_info += "\n${s.key}: ${s.value}"
}
def output_d = new File( "${params.outdir}/pipeline_info/" )
if( !output_d.exists() ) {
output_d.mkdirs()
}
def output_tf = new File( output_d, "pipeline_report.txt" )
output_tf.withWriter { w -> w << email_info }
// make txt template
def engine = new groovy.text.GStringTemplateEngine()
def tf = new File("$baseDir/assets/email_template.txt")
def txt_template = engine.createTemplate(tf).make(email_fields)
def email_txt = txt_template.toString()
// make email template
def hf = new File("$baseDir/assets/email_template.html")
def html_template = engine.createTemplate(hf).make(email_fields)
def email_html = html_template.toString()
def subject = "Diagnostic exome analysis finished ($params.run_name)."
if (params.email) {
def mqc_report = null
try {
if (workflow.success && !params.skip_multiqc) {
mqc_report = multiqc_report.getVal()
if (mqc_report.getClass() == ArrayList){
log.warn "[IKMB ExoSeq] Found multiple reports from process 'multiqc', will use only one"
mqc_report = mqc_report[-1]
}
}
} catch (all) {
log.warn "[IKMB ExoSeq] Could not attach MultiQC report to summary email"
}
def smail_fields = [ email: params.email, subject: subject, email_txt: email_txt, email_html: email_html, baseDir: "$baseDir", mqcFile: mqc_report, mqcMaxSize: params.maxMultiqcEmailFileSize.toBytes() ]
def sf = new File("$baseDir/assets/sendmail_template.txt")
def sendmail_template = engine.createTemplate(sf).make(smail_fields)
def sendmail_html = sendmail_template.toString()
try {
if( params.plaintext_email ){ throw GroovyException('Send plaintext e-mail, not HTML') }
// Try to send HTML e-mail using sendmail
[ 'sendmail', '-t' ].execute() << sendmail_html
} catch (all) {
// Catch failures and try with plaintext
[ 'mail', '-s', subject, params.email ].execute() << email_txt
}
}
}
